المحتويات:
Introduction : global formations and recalcitrances / Keith Hanley and Greg Kucich -- Traveling natures / Alan Bewell -- Jeffrey Brace in Barbados : slavery, interracial relationships, and the emergence of global economy / Kari J. Winter -- "Savages" into spectators/consumers : globalization in advertising posters, 1890-1900s / Ruth E. Iskin -- "A prodigious map beneath his feet" : virtual travel and the panoramic perspective / Alison Byerly -- Citizens of the world : émigrés, romantic cosmopolitanism, and Charlotte Smith / Adriana Craciun -- The ghost of Matthew Arnold : Englishness and the politics of culture / Simon Gikandi -- Typologies of the East : on distinguishing Balkanism and Orientalism / Andrew Hammond -- "That imperious passion" : self as vortex in Don Juan's Russian affair / Adam Komisaruk -- Geographical imaginations of the "Holy Land": Biblical topography and archaeological practice / Charlotte Whiting -- Constructions of sacred topography : the nineteenth century and today / Basem L. Ra'ad -- Peripheral modernities : national and global in a post-Colonial frame / Luke Gibbons -- The middle passages of Nancy Prince and Harriet Jacobs / Robin Miskolcze -- In perilous waters : single female migration to post-penal Tasmania / Miranda Morris -- The political economy of the potato / David Lloyd -- Deathscapes : India in an age of Romanticism and empire, 1800-1856 / David Arnold.
